He had been limping on his left hind leg for about a week so I took him to see the vet. We had X-rays done and the news was not good. It turns out Bodhi has necrosis of the femoral head. The hip is a "ball and socket" joint. The femoral head is the "ball" part of the joint and if it develops necrosis or dies, it can no longer function properly. Necrosis is due to loss of the blood supply to the femoral head or "ball, which may be the result of a growth abnormality. It is a hereditary condition of small breed young dogs. The treatment of choice is femoral head and neck ostectomy or removal of the femoral head and neck. The surgery is estimated to be $2,065.
